--- title: Stable Layers emoji: 🗂️ colorFrom: yellow colorTo: purple sdk: gradio sdk_version: 6.22.0 app_file: app.py pinned: false short_description: Split an image into editable RGBA layers python_version: "3.12" startup_duration_timeout: 1h license: other license_name: stabilityai-community license_link: https://stability.ai/license models: - StabilityLabs/Stable-Layers - Qwen/Qwen-Image-Layered tags: - layer-decomposition - rgba - image-editing - lora --- # 🗂️ Stable Layers Split any image into a stack of **editable RGBA layers** — an inpainted background plus one object per layer — with [StabilityLabs/Stable-Layers](https://huggingface.co/StabilityLabs/Stable-Layers), a LoRA over the [Qwen/Qwen-Image-Layered](https://huggingface.co/Qwen/Qwen-Image-Layered) pipeline (20.4B DiT). ## What you get Layers come out **back-to-front**: layer 0 is the background, repainted behind everything that was lifted off it; each higher layer is one object with real alpha. Stacking them all reproduces the original image. Every layer is downloadable as a genuine transparent PNG (single layer or the whole set as a ZIP), ready to drop into an editor. ## Inference Locked to the recipe the authors specify, because deviating from it garbles the decomposition: | Setting | Value | |---|---| | Sampler | Heun (2nd order) | | Steps | 50 | | CFG | 1.0 (off) | | Max dimension | 640 px | | Layers | 4 (2–6 selectable) | The `QwenImageLayeredPipeline.__call__` path (Euler + `true_cfg_scale=4.0`) is the *base model's* recipe, so this Space reimplements the reference [`decompose.py`](https://github.com/Stability-AI/Stable-Layers) denoise loop directly. The adapter is a raw PEFT checkpoint on `QwenImageTransformer2DModel` whose keys carry no `transformer.` prefix, so it is applied with `PeftModel.from_pretrained(...)` + `merge_and_unload()` rather than `load_lora_weights` (which silently no-ops on it). Runs on ZeroGPU at `size="xlarge"`: the transformer (40.9 GB), the Qwen2.5-VL text encoder (16.6 GB) and the RGBA VAE total ~58 GB of bf16 weights, over the 48 GB `large` slice. Transformer blocks are served from an ahead-of-time-compiled (AOTInductor) package when one is available, with an automatic eager fallback. ## Credits Model by [Stability AI](https://huggingface.co/StabilityLabs), released under the [Stability AI Community License](https://stability.ai/license).
